| Diurnal patterns of lower atmospheric pollution in two urbanized valleys | | Comparison of the diurnal transport of lower atmospheric pollution in Phoenix, Arizona (USA) with the daily variability of air pollution in another urbanized valley, Kathmandu, Nepal. Evidence suggest that the physical setting of Kathmandu partially accounts for the diurnal variability of pollutant levels in the capital city of the Kingdom of Nepal. Also suggests that other factors, such as vehicular traffic, industrial emissions, and the use of kerosene stoves account for some of the variability in Kathmandu. |
